Overview

The International Rescue Committee (IRC) responds to humanitarian crises by restoring health, safety, education, economic wellbeing, and power to people affected by conflict and disaster. The IRC operates in more than 40 countries and 29 U.S. cities, delivering aid and rebuilding lives. The Awards Management Unit (AMU) within the Crisis Response, Recovery & Development (CRRD) department identifies, secures and manages funding from government donors and supports IRC staff working on awards.

Global Business Development leads IRC’s public BD strategy and donor engagement for international programs, uniting technical, operational and donor specialists to secure public funding.

The Purpose of the Role

The Donor Engagement Director manages a portfolio of priority donors for IRC. They will lead and coordinate donor engagement that currently includes the World Bank, UN agencies and governments (including Canada, the US and Gulf states). The role will develop emerging partnerships with other key donors and will work alongside the Director of European Donor Engagement. The position oversees a team of Senior Advisors and leads an internal and external account management function to manage engagement with these donors.

The role engages with portfolio donors at high levels, guiding donor relations, and collaborating with technical and proposal development teams to secure funding.

The Donor Engagement Director will lead the development and implementation of proactive donor and partner engagement strategies for the entire IRC organization, engaging technical, regional, country and operational teams as well as policy colleagues and the executive board.

The role requires collaboration with counterpart leadership and other senior staff to plan and execute donor engagement initiatives and to pursue strategic opportunities for influence.
